Gene-specific Primers

Gene-specific primers for PCR-based applications are commercially available. These ready-to-use oligonucleotide sets usually come in pairs, including the forward and reverse primers. In eliminating the step of manually designing primer sequences for genes of interest, these primers can accelerate molecular experiments in gene expression and in the detection of biomarkers, microbes, and viruses.
